Income tax, state; tax credit for certain small businesses.

Virginia · 2026 Regular Session · lower

Description

Income tax; tax credit for certain small businesses. Establishes a one-time, nonrefundable tax credit for taxable years 2026 through 2030 for eligible small businesses, as defined in the bill, equal to $2,500. The bill limits the total aggregate amount of small business credits claimed to $5 million per taxable year.
